About N-[4-[4-(2-methylpropyl)phenyl]-1,3-thiazol-2-yl]-2-(2,5,7-trimethyl-4,6-dioxopyrazolo[3,4-d]pyrimidin-3-yl)acetamide

N-[4-[4-(2-methylpropyl)phenyl]-1,3-thiazol-2-yl]-2-(2,5,7-trimethyl-4,6-dioxopyrazolo[3,4-d]pyrimidin-3-yl)acetamide (PubChem CID 46945436) has the molecular formula C23H26N6O3S and a molecular weight of 466.57 g/mol. Its IUPAC name is N-[4-[4-(2-methylpropyl)phenyl]-1,3-thiazol-2-yl]-2-(2,5,7-trimethyl-4,6-dioxopyrazolo[3,4-d]pyrimidin-3-yl)acetamide.
